Almaty, December 23 (Xinhua) — Pensions and benefits in Kazakhstan will be increased by 10 percent starting January 1, 2026. This was announced by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of National Economy Serik Zhumangarin on Tuesday.

S. Zhumangarin reported that the 2025 social budget amounted to 5.9 trillion tenge (approximately 11.46 billion US dollars), and in 2026 it will reach 6.8 trillion tenge (approximately 13.2 billion US dollars).

"Pensions and benefits will be increased by 10 percent. For comparison, in 2025 it was 8.5 percent. In the 2026 budget, we have allocated 636 billion tenge (approximately $1.23 billion) for increasing pensions and benefits alone," the minister noted.

At the same time, according to him, the wage fund has consistently amounted to around 31 percent of the country's gross domestic product for several years.

"And this year, I hope, we'll cross the $300 billion mark for the first time. We might even reach $15,000 per capita," added S. Zhumangarin.

New York, December 23 (Xinhua) — The U.S. consumer confidence index fell to 89.1 in December, down from a revised 92.9 in November, research organization The Conference Board reported on Tuesday.

Data show that US consumers have become more pessimistic about current business and employment conditions, despite a stable expectations index of 70.7 amid persistent economic uncertainty heading into the end of the year. –0–

Beijing, December 23 (Xinhua) — China urges Ukraine to immediately correct its mistakes, Chinese Foreign Ministry spokesperson Lin Jian said on Tuesday, vowing that China will resolutely protect the legitimate rights and interests of Chinese businesses and citizens.

The diplomat made the statement at a regular departmental briefing, commenting on statements by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y about the imminent introduction of new sanctions against Russian businesses and individuals providing assistance to Russia, including citizens of other countries, such as China.

Lin Jian pointed out that China consistently opposes unilateral sanctions that violate international law and have not received the approval of the UN Security Council.

Speaking about China's role in the ongoing efforts to peacefully resolve the Ukrainian crisis, Lin Jian noted that since the beginning of the Ukrainian crisis, China has maintained close communication with all parties involved, including Russia and Ukraine, and has made continuous efforts to end the hostilities and advance peace talks.

“China’s efforts are clear to the entire international community,” the Chinese Foreign Ministry’s official representative noted.

Lin Jian stressed that the Chinese side supports all efforts to promote peace and will continue to play a constructive role in this regard.

Kyiv, December 23 (Xinhua) — On Tuesday night, Russia launched a massive attack on Ukraine, primarily targeting the country's energy and other civilian infrastructure, using over 650 drones and more than 30 missiles.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y announced this on Telegram.

According to him, at least 13 regions of the country came under fire, a significant portion of Russian drones and missiles were shot down, but hits were recorded at several locations.

V. Zelensky added that the Russian attack also resulted in the deaths of at least three people, including a 4-year-old child. –0–

BANGKOK, December 23 (Xinhua) — Thailand highly appreciates China's role in helping de-escalate tensions on the Thai-Cambodia border, Foreign Ministry spokesperson Nikorndey Balankura said on Tuesday.

Speaking at a briefing on the border situation later that day, N. Balankura said Thailand highly appreciates China's participation and role in de-escalating the Thai-Cambodian conflict and thanked China for upholding an objective and impartial position.

The press secretary also informed the press about Thailand's participation in the special ASEAN Foreign Ministers' Meeting held on Monday. He reaffirmed Thailand's commitment to resolving the issue through bilateral mechanisms, emphasizing that any sustainable solution must be reached directly by Thailand and Cambodia.

On Wednesday, Thailand will host a meeting of the General Border Committee, where military representatives from both countries will hold consultations on ceasefire issues.

Moscow, December 23 (Xinhua) – Russia and the United States held another round of contacts to address mutual irritants in bilateral relations, Russian Deputy Foreign Minister Sergei Ryabkov said in an interview with the Interfax news agency on Tuesday.

"The latest round of contacts on so-called irritants has taken place. It took place at a working level. We had the opportunity to discuss the entire agenda at a fairly serious, professional, and in-depth level," noted Sergei Ryabkov.

He emphasized that there has been progress on certain topics. "I can't say there's been significant progress—there are some areas where progress is being made, but the main issues remain unresolved," the diplomat said, summing up the consultations.

According to the Russian Deputy Foreign Minister, further progress will require additional efforts. "I don't rule out the possibility of political incentives to move forward," he added.

S. Ryabkov reported that the next round of Russian-American contacts on mutual irritants will take place approximately in early spring. –0–

Washington, December 23 (Xinhua) — US President Donald Trump announced on Monday the construction of two new Trump-class battleships for the US Navy. He said these warships will be "the fastest, largest, and 100 times more powerful than any battleship ever built."

At a press conference with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th, Secretary of State Marco Rubio, and Navy Secretary John Phelan, Trump announced that he had approved a plan for the Navy to build two of the largest battleships ever built by the United States. Eight more will be built soon after, for a total of 20-25 battleships.

D. Trump stated that new warships with a displacement of 30-40 thousand tons will be equipped with hypersonic weapons, railguns, cruise missiles and laser weapons and will become the flagships of the US Navy.

J. Phelan said the Trump-class battleship will be the largest, deadliest, most versatile and most beautiful warship in the world.

That same day, the US Department of Defense released a statement saying the new type of warship is currently in the design phase, with the first new battleship scheduled for completion in the early 2030s. –0–

Bogota, December 23 (Xinhua) — The Colombian government on Monday issued a decree declaring a state of economic and social emergency in the country for 30 days, local media reported.

According to reports, the move is aimed at overcoming the difficult situation the country is going through and taking the necessary measures to contain the spread of the crisis.

Media analysis shows that the direct cause of the state of emergency was the government's proposed tax reform bill, which was rejected by Congress on December 9, leaving Colombia's 2026 national budget facing a budget deficit of approximately 16 trillion Colombian pesos (approximately US$4.2 billion).

The decree states that after declaring a state of emergency, the government may issue legally binding decrees to address the crisis and prevent its spread. It may also temporarily introduce new taxes or amend existing ones.

BEIJING, Dec. 23 (Xinhua) — China's Ministry of Housing, Urban-Rural Development vowed to stabilize the property market by unveiling a package of city-specific measures to reduce inventory and optimize supply.

Key measures include adjusting new supply to local conditions, activating existing land resources, improving the provision of state-subsidized housing, and more active support for the reasonable financial needs of real estate developers, according to Ni Hong, Minister of Housing, Urban-Rural Development, at an industry meeting in Beijing.

He stated that municipal authorities should make full use of their autonomy in regulating the real estate market, adjusting and optimizing real estate policies as necessary to support residents' basic and growing housing needs, thereby promoting the stable functioning of the real estate market.

Regarding housing sales, Ni Hong emphasized the need to promote the sale of completed new housing to reduce the risks of delivery of properties and strengthen control over down payments in pre-sale real estate projects.

The Ministry will also improve the housing savings fund system and take measures to improve real estate services. -0-
